Hi Team,

i have created the user manager campagin for employment verification only and selected "Create Revoke Task for Terminated User & Revoked/Conditional Certified Acc. & Ent. on Locking".  when i complete the certification.

It created the revoke task for accounts and marked saviynt user as inactive and added a comments in saviynt user profile stating "user are being terminated through certificaiton".

Till here it looks good.
==========================================

i have created a new  user manager campagin for employment verification only and selected "Create Revoke Task For Unresponded Item on Expiry".  I didnt opened the campaign till the expiration time and when the campaign got expired. all i can see is revoke task for account is created. However, the saviynt user status is still active. 

What i am expecting is this should have same behaviour as above flow when i complete the certificaiton. when it expires it should mark  the saviynt user to inactive and add comments on saviynt user profile.

 

Please let me know if above is expected OOTB behaviour or not.

Hi @iam01 

Access Reviews will only revoke user's account and access. It will not deactivate any user if no action was taken.
